I'm speaking at the CBAA Convention in Calgary this year. Innovation Stage, Thursday June 11, 11:15 AM.

The title is "Stop Renting Your Software. Build It with AI." It's a primer on AI-assisted development and what it means for the business aviation IT landscape.

Here's the short version. Business aviation is a small market, so vendors build one generic tool, charge a premium, and price it per seat so your best year costs you the most. You bend your operation to fit the software because the software was never going to bend to you. For thirty years that math was real, and operators were right to be skeptical of spending on tech. The math just changed.

We've spent the last couple of years building custom software for operators with AI. Some of it the industry was told was impossible — including the first Transport Canada-approved AI-written MEL, and an AI-authored MEL for the first hydrogen-powered aircraft in Canada. Both regulated. Both approved.

The talk isn't a pitch. I'll cover what "build it with AI" actually means, the new build-versus-buy calculus, and the honest caveats — including the part where you still need one technical person who can steer it.
